Great hair cut/color - bad wax. I have been to the Spa Club twice. The first time I got both my hair and eyebrows done and the second time I just got my eyebrows done. The beautician that did my hair did a great job. She was talkative and sweet and really listened to my hair phobias before proceeding. The cut and highlight that I got were exactly what I was hoping to achieve by going there!

However, my eyebrow experience was awful! The first time I got my eyebrows done I had to point out all of the hairs that the wax did not pick up and after showing the lady three times, I finally just got frustrated and did it myself. I went back the second time hoping that the first time was a fluke...but I was disappointed again with a very similar outcome...except that one of my eyebrows was thicker than the other!
